Retro Waves is an abstract painting that translates the essence of retro aesthetics into a contemporary work of art. The design is characterised by flowing, undulating shapes in soft pastel tones and earth tones. This balanced colour combination evokes a sense of harmony and timeless elegance, seamlessly merging nostalgia and modernity.
The composition consists of a play of overlapping shapes, suggesting depth and movement. The wavy lines and subtle colour transitions reinforce the association with natural elements, such as sand dunes, flowing water and soft horizon lines. The work plays with contrasts: between warm earthy nuances and pastel tones, and between the organic forms and the stylised simplicity of the design.
This painting is not only a visual addition to an interior, but also functions as a source of tranquillity and inspiration. Thanks to its subdued colours and abstract shapes, Retro Waves fits into a variety of spaces, from minimalist interiors to retro-inspired environments. The work offers a subtle yet powerful presence that enriches the visual rhythm of a space.
‘RETRO WAVES’ is painting made with acrylic paint.
